One New Cozy Mystery Series and One Holiday-Themed Cozies Coming December 2019

November 15, 2019

December will be a decent month for Cozy Mystery releases, with one new Cozy Mystery series by an established site author and one new Holiday-Themed Cozy Mystery.

First up, Amanda Flower (aka Isabella Alan) will be putting out the first in her new Amish Matchmaker Mystery Series, titled Matchmaking Can Be Murder. Millie Fisher is returning to her hometown of Harvest, Ohio, after the death of her husband, and has decided to branch out from her normal trade, quiltmaking, and begin matchmaking, with her niece being her first target. Unfortunately, her niece is already betrothed to a thoroughly unsuitable candidate, but Millie manages to convince her to break it off. But when the jilted lover turns up dead, Millie’s niece quickly becomes a prime suspect, and Millie will need to work hard to keep her out of jail! Amanda Flower also writes (among others) the Amish Candy Shop Mystery Series, the Magical Bookshop Mystery Series, and the Magical Garden Mystery Series.

Also, Cynthia Baxter will be releasing Last Licks, the third in her Lickety Splits Ice Cream Shoppe Mystery Series. Kate McKay, owner of Lickety Splits is preparing for Halloween, but she’s derailed somewhat by the offer of an offer by a Hollywood movie crew to use her shop as part of the production. Unfortunately, someone else seems to have more sinister motives than making a movie, and one of the actresses ends up dead by poison – poison apparently delivered by ice cream. Cynthia Baxter is also the author of the Reigning Cats & Dogs Mystery Series and the Murder Packs a Suitcase Mystery Series.

Two New Cozy Mystery Series and Two Holiday-Themed Cozies Coming October 2019

October 20, 2019

November will be a fairly good month for Cozies by site authors, though not as good as this month – “only” two new series by established authors and two holiday-themed Cozies, both Christmas!

The first new series release will be the Woman of WWII Mystery Series, a period piece by Tessa Arlen set during the second World War. It’s 1942, three years into the war, and Poppy Redfern’s family home and farm have been requisitioned by the War Office as an airfield for the American Air Force, and Poppy keeps her days and nights busy serving as the village’s Air Raid Warden. Tensions between the locals and the American servicemen are already running high – even before two young women who were dating Americans are found dead. With local manpower at a low point, Poppy decides she needs to start her own investigation to keep the peace between the two allied nations. Tessa Arlen is also the author of the Lady Montfort Mystery Series, another period piece, this one set in Edwardian England.

The other new series will be Sally Chapman‘s Agatha’s Amish B&B Mystery Series, which will start with Dead Wrong. Fifty-five year old widow Agatha Lapp is staring a new phrase in her life, relocating to a newly established Amish Community in Hunt, Texas, to make a success of her recently deceased brother’s dream – to start an Amish bed and breakfast. The dream seems to be off to a bad start, as she discovers the body of a visitor in one of her guest cabins. The police think the death was natural causes, but Agatha and her neighbor Tony Vargas, a retired detective, think otherwise. Sally Chapman is also the author of the Silicon Valley Mystery Series and (as Annie Griffin) the Hannah & Kiki Mystery Series.

The first of the Christmas Cozies will be Upon the Midnight Clear, a short story entry featured in Tasha Alexander‘s Lady Emily Mystery Series. Lady Emily is preparing for Christmas with her family with a few days in the city when her son is given a Christmas cracker with a cryptic clue within it. Shortly after, she’s approached by another stranger who pleads for her help finding his long-lost daughter, who he believes to be somewhere in the city – and more mysterious crackers continue to arrive to help her on her investigation.

The other Christmas Cozy will be An Ale of Two Cities, the second story in Sarah Fox‘s Literary Pub Mystery Series. Christmas in Shady Creek, Vermont, is always an influx of tourist cash, with the town’s picturesque Winter Carnival featuring a wide variety of attractions. One such is the return of the town’s former resident, celebrity chef Freddy Mancini, who arrives to show off his ice-sculpting skills… until he turns up dead with a pick in his chest! Sarah Fox is also the author of the Pancake House Mystery Series and the Music Lover’s Mystery Series.

Two New Non-Christmas Holiday-Themed Cozies and One New Cozy Mystery Series Coming October 2019

September 19, 2019

October will be another very busy month for Cozy Mysteries, with a whopping 8 holiday-themed Cozies and one new Cozy Mystery Series by an established author! Well, normally with that many I would split them into two posts… but here, the new series is starting with a holiday release! So I’m just going to arbitrarily split them into two groups, one of non-Christmas mysteries and the new series, and save the just-Christmas mysteries for this weekend. That leaves us with three for today!

First up, Lynn Cahoon will be putting out A Very Mummy Holiday, which will be either a novella in the Tourist Trap Mystery Series or a novella in the series. (Unfortunately Amazon doesn’t have a length for this one…) Jill is taking a break from her book and coffee shop to spend Thanksgiving on the Oregon coast with her boyfriend and a bunch of other friends and family. But the holiday might be cut short when one of the other guests locates old human remains in the nearby dunes, and she’ll need to put her holiday on hold to make sure that the mystery gets solved. Lynn Cahoon is also the author of the Cat Latimer Mystery Series starring a former English professor and the Farm-to-Fork Mystery Series starring the owner of a farm to table restaurant. 

Next, Isis Crawford will be putting out A Catered New Year’s Eve, the 15th in the Mystery With Recipes Mystery Series. Bernie and Libby Simmons are reuniting with Ada Sinclair, a distant relative for New Years’s Eve, catering for a questionable ploy to flush out the murderer of another relative year’s ago. Naturally, this goes wrong, and when one of the guests Ada planned on accusing ends up dead, Ada ends up arrested for the deed. Bernie and Libby are the only ones who can find the true culprit. Crawford also writes as Barbara Block, the name she uses for the Robin Light Mystery Series, starring a pet store owner.

Finally, the last for this set will be Julie Anne Lindsey‘s Apple Cider Slaying, a Christmas mystery and the first in her new Cider Shop Mystery Series! Wonona Mae Montgomery and her Granny Smythe run a struggling orchard in Blossom Valley, West Virginia, but have decided to try to make up some business with a Christmas party at the orchard geared toward locals and tourists alike. Unfortunately, the party will be crashed by the corpse of Granny’s old nemesis, leaving Granny the most obvious suspect! Julie Anne Lindsey writes several other short series, including the Fortress Defense Mystery Series, the Geek Girl Mystery Series, and the Patience Price Mystery Series.

One New Cozy Mystery Series and Three New Holiday-Themed Cozies Coming August 2019

July 19, 2019

August will be a good month for Cozies, with a good mix of new series by established site authors and holiday entries in older series.

First, T.C. LoTempio will be starting a new series, the Purr N’ Bark Pet Shop Mystery Series, with The Time for Murder is Meow. When the cancellation of actress Crishell “Shell” McMillan’s television show leaves her at loose ends, she takes the opportunity to do what she’s wanted for some time, taking over her late aunt’s pet shop. But when a local museum board member who had feuded with her aunt turns up dead, Shell quickly becomes the first suspect. LoTempio also writes the Cat Rescue Mystery Series and the Nick and Nora Mystery Series.

Ginger Bolton will be putting out a Fourth of July themed mystery, Jealousy Filled Donuts, the third in her Deputy Donut Mystery Series. Emily Westhill, owner and operator of the Deputy Donut Cafe, is preparing dozens of donuts for the local Fourth of July picnic. Unfortunately, a killer uses the donuts for sinister purposes, concealing a firecracker within a pile that ends up killing a local. Bolton also writes as Janet Bolin, under which name she writes the Threadville Mystery Series.

Maya Corrigan will be releasing a Halloween themed mystery, Crypt Suzette, the sixth in her Five-Ingredient Mystery Series. Val Deniston, manager of the Cool Down Cafe at the local fitness club, has been wondering about a lodger at her grandfather’s house, Suzette, who seems to have something of a nervous disposition and possibly a checkered past. When Suzette is killed by a hit-and-run driver after a Halloween costume contest, Val decides someone needs to investigate the issue a bit more thoroughly.

Finally, Vicki Delany will be releasing Silent Night, Deadly Night, a Thanksgiving novel and the fourth entry in her Year-Round Christmas Mystery Series. While the residents of Rudolph, New York, might keep the Christmas spirit up year round, that doesn’t mean they don’t celebrate other holidays, and Merry Wilkinson is preparing for both Thanksgiving and a reunion of her mother’s old college friends. When one of the old friends ends up poisoned, Merry will need to help solve this dastardly case to help salvage the holiday cheer. Vicki Delany also writes the Sherlock Holmes Bookshop Mystery Series, the Ashley Grant Mystery Series, the Ray Robertson Mystery Series, the Klondike Mystery Series, and (as Eva Gates) the Lighthouse Library Mystery Series.
